Abstract In the networking designing phase, the network needs to be built according to certain indicators to ensure that the network has the ideal functions and can work smoothly. From a modeling perspective, each site in the network is represented by a vertex, channels between sites are represented by edges, and thus the entire network can be denoted as a graph. Problems in the network can be transformed into corresponding graph problems. In particular, the feasibility of data transmission can be transformed into the existence of fractional factors in network graph. This note gives an independent set neighborhood union condition for the existence of fractional factors in a special setting, and shows that the neighborhood union condition is sharp.

Lithuania in Polish Foreign Policy in the Years 2007–2014Lithuania plays a crucial part in the Polish eastern policy. Poland shares a complicated past with its north-eastern neighbour as well as many common interests. One can call it “a love-hate relationship”. The main purpose of this article is to investigate Polish-Lithuanian relations in four main areas: energy recourses and transmission lines; security and democratisation in the Eastern Europe; cooperation within the European Union; condition of minorities. The article focuses on ears 2007–2014 when Donald Tusk was the Prime Minister of Poland and the Ministry of Foreign Affairs was led by Radosław Sikorski. The paper also presents the role of the Polish president and parliament.

Mulberry (Morus sp.; Moraceae) is a perennial tree crop, which provides sustainable economic and environmental benefits. Its foliage is the only natural feed available for the silkworm Bombyx mori Linneaus for the production of silk. The mulberry germplasm of the Sericulture Research and Development Institute, Don Mariano Marcos Memorial State University (DMMMSU-SRDI), maintains different exotic and indigenous collections. This study aimed to select breeding materials with high propagation traits for crop improvement and to identify suitable parent materials. Pooled data of 2009 and 2010 evaluations on sprouting, rooting and root proliferation rate at 20, 60 and 90DAP, respectively, were subjected to Analysis of Variance. Selection of variety was done using the Least Significant Difference (LSD) using Batac a widely used a variety for cocoon production, as check variety. Result revealed that there was no significant variation among the 32 mulberry collections as to the number and weight of roots and root-shoot ratio by length and weight. Identified parent materials for improved rooting capacity are S3, Papua, King, MA, Collection2 and H4, thus, considered for drought resistance. Let $G$ be an edge-colored graph. A heterochromatic (rainbow, or multicolored) path of $G$ is such a path in which no two edges have the same color. Let $CN(v)$ denote the color neighborhood of a vertex $v$ of $G$. In a previous paper, we showed that if $|CN(u)\cup CN(v)|\geq s$ (color neighborhood union condition) for every pair of vertices $u$ and $v$ of $G$, then $G$ has a heterochromatic path of length at least $\lfloor{2s+4\over5}\rfloor$. In the present paper, we prove that $G$ has a heterochromatic path of length at least $\lceil{s+1\over2}\rceil$, and give examples to show that the lower bound is best possible in some sense.
